The Current State of AI Adoption

To understand the current state of AI, it's essential to look at the data. The world's population is roughly 8 billion people. Out of these, a staggering 84% of the global working-age population has never used AI. This translates to approximately 6.8 billion people who have never typed a single prompt into any AI interface. To put this into perspective, only about 16% of the global population has interacted with a free chatbot even once or twice. The number of people who pay for AI services is even smaller, constituting only about 0.3% of the global population, or roughly 20 million people.

The AI User Base

The serious user base of AI, which includes those who actively build and pay for AI technologies, is relatively small. Of the global population of 8 billion, only a fraction is actively engaged with AI. The active AI builders are estimated to be around 2 to 5 million people. This small user base, though significant in terms of innovation and development, represents a tiny percentage of the global population.

The AI Bubble Misconception

The idea of an AI bubble is often discussed in tech circles, but it is largely a misconception. The bubble talk comes from those who live in environments where AI usage is ubiquitous, such as tech Twitter. In these circles, it feels like everyone is using AI daily, leading to the perception that the market is saturated and the technology is overhyped. However, stepping outside of this echo chamber reveals a very different reality. The truth is that AI adoption is still in its very early stages.
